The Meaning Behind The Song: Lágrimas de Miel by Adriel Favela
| Title | Lágrimas de Miel |
|---|---|
| Artist | Adriel Favela |
| Writer/Composer | Brandon Reyes & Adriel Favela |
| Album | Cosas Del Diablo (2022) |
| Release Date | March 4, 2022 |
| Genre | Pop |
| Producer | Tipo Country, Danny Felix, Trooko & Adriel Favela |
“Lágrimas de Miel” is a captivating song by Adriel Favela that explores the bittersweet experiences of love and heartache. With its soul-stirring lyrics and melodic composition, listeners are taken on a journey through the complexities of emotions.
The song opens with evocative lines: “Un jarabe extraño dentro de mi vaso / Con media pastilla pa’ andar relajado” (A strange syrup inside my glass / With half a pill to be relaxed). These lyrics immediately set the tone for the song, expressing a desire to numb the pain of a broken heart. Favela beautifully captures the feeling of seeking solace in unhealthy coping mechanisms to forget someone who no longer reciprocates their love.
The next lines, “Me estoy medicando, te estoy olvidando / Pero no funciona, ¿qué me está pasando?” (I’m medicating myself, trying to forget you / But it’s not working, what’s happening to me?), reflect the protagonist’s struggle to move on despite their attempts to self-medicate. This resonates with anyone who has ever fought to let go of a love that still lingers in their heart.
In the chorus, Favela sings, “Lágrimas de miel las que vas a llorar / Porque alguien dulce, mi amor, jamás / Como yo volverás a encontrar” (You will cry honey tears / Because someone sweet, my love, you will never find / Like me). These powerful lines highlight the importance of self-worth and self-love. The protagonist acknowledges their value and asserts that they cannot be replaced by someone who does not appreciate their sweetness.
As the song progresses, Favela’s lyrics delve into the symbolic significance of fame and money. He sings, “Fama y dinero lo que nos va a llegar / Pero el corazón vacío está / Y nada lo puede compensar” (Fame and money is what will come to us / But the heart is empty / And nothing can compensate). This poignant verse expresses the emptiness that material success can bring when true love is absent.

The song’s bridge, “Voy pa’ leyenda y no me estanco, si me caigo me levanto / Ya lo pasado pasado, soy cabrón y no me rajo / Si me tumban y me engañan, créanme / Me vuelvo a levantar” (I’m going for the legend and I don’t get stuck, if I fall I get up / What’s done is done, I’m tough and I don’t give up / If they knock me down and deceive me, believe me / I rise again), serves as an empowering reminder of resilience and determination. Favela asserts his commitment to rise above adversity and continue striving for greatness.
